Professional Experience
Joanne brings a breadth of life and professional experience to her counselling practice. Before training as a counsellor, she spent ten years working in the corporate sector as an engineer, followed by fifteen years as an educator, mentor, and leader.
As both a parent and long-term teacher, Joanne understands the complexities of raising children through different developmental stages. She also understands the pressures young people face as they navigate study, relationships, identity, and the transition from school into work, university, and adult life.
Joanne’s own experience as a counselling client has deeply shaped her approach. It has given her a strong appreciation for the courage it takes to seek support, and for the growth that can emerge within a safe and trusting therapeutic relationship. This perspective informs the warmth, humility, and care she brings to her work with clients.
